Time Again for Back to school Shopping

It is July, summer is in full swing, and the thought of school is far from the minds of children all across the country. Parents and merchants, on the other hand, are thinking towards the school year ahead, which is just weeks away. With the rising cost of gasoline, climbing food prices, and plenty of talk about recession, back to school shoppers are sure to be conscious of their spending. That's bad news for stores, as this is one of the most important shopping periods of the year.

Save on Prescription Drugs

According to a recent report, more than half of insured Americans are now taking at least one prescription drug for a chronic condition. At the same time, the price of prescription medications has skyrocketed, employers have boosted co-payments, and insurers place restrictions on covered medications. There are some techniques to avoid most of the pain without having to cross the Canadian border.
